7 Key Features in the Best Toys

By Laurie Winslow Sargent:

With the glut of toys on the market, how can you choose the best toys for your child? Look for these 7 key features.

In my mind, the best toys or games are safe, plus have several or all of the following features related to play value:

 

  • Can be played with in a variety of ways and stimulate some imagination
  • Teach more than one skill
  • Appeal to several age groups
  • Encourage positive behavior and learning
  • Are fun (for the child—and hopefully for the parent, too)
  • Get frequent, long-term use and stimulate interest in independent play
  • Offer a window into what the child is thinking or feeling

Toys that don’t meet many of these qualifications can be a waste of money and do little but create clutter in your home.

Once when the UPS man delivered a huge box of toys for me to review, the neighbor kids were gathered in my yard. Reviewing the toys became a group project. One thumbs-down preschool toy was designed so poorly it made us all laugh. A catapult was supposed to launch plastic treats (with numbers on them) into a creature’s plastic mouth. Theoretically, it was designed to teach child recognition of the numbers one through five.  Realistically, correctly loading and launching the catapult required the motor skills of a child who could count to fifty. Of course my creative crowd found other things to launch with the toy until the catapult fell off.

A much better toy, one that all three of my children loved, was a set of Measure Up Cups, which can be used to “dump, fill, nest, stack and stamp. These volumetrically correct, sequentially numbered cups introduce important preschool concepts related to volume, size, time, color and measurement.”

The toy is described as appropriate for children from 12 months through primary school, but an infant can also play with the larger cups. That means the toy can be played with by the same child for four to five years–and my kids did.

The manufacturer’s site describes 16 different ways you can play with the Measure Up Cups. I’ve modified their list a bit to focus on games you can play with your baby, toddler or preschooler.

Games to Play with Measure Up Cups

  • Stack into a tower to knock down. (Toddlers love to do this, and don’t realize they’re learning cause and effect.)
  • Build a castle (the scalloped edges make great castle turrets). This can lead to some fun pretend play with preschoolers. This is a new feature my kids’ cups didn’t have. Neat!
  • Scoop, fill and pour water, sand, rice or small safe objects. At the same time your child learns mathematical concepts, since the contents of cup #1 plus cup #2 equals the contents of cup #3.
  • Nest the cups to learn about size and relationships. This also helps your toddler’s motor skills.
  • Practice number recognition with your toddler; the cups are numbered both on the outside and inside on the bottom. For fun, a child can put a corresponding number of small, safe objects in each cup.
  • Learn English, French and Spanish words for numbers as those words are stamped on the sides of the cups. This is also new, awesome feature to extend the fun even through early elementary school.
  • Practice color identification as your child sorts and stacks the cups.
  • Hide objects under the cups, then reveal them. This can teach a baby object permanence, but also can be fun for illusion tricks with preschoolers.
  • Touch and feel numbers with your eyes closed, inside the cup on the bottom.
  • Identify animals on the bottoms of the cups with your baby.
  • Stamp the animal designs into dough or wet sand with your preschooler.  Point out to your child that the designs grow progressively larger as the cups increase in size.
  • Trace around the cups and then match the cups to the right sized circles.
  • Practice telling time with your preschooler: the designs on the outside of the cups correspond to clock face positions–another new feature.

As a recap, to choose the best toys for your children, look for ones that can be played with in many ways, stimulate creativity and imagination, teach more than one skill to more than one age group, and make learning fun. The best toys will be used often and your child will enjoy playing with them by himself but also with you. Great toys can actually make parenting more exciting, when through parent-child play you see your child thinking, learning new skills and reaching new milestones.

Fun and Learning with Picture Puzzles (8 Developmental Stages)

Puzzles can offer a window into your child’s mind, helping you see how he thinks and problem solves.


I still remember learning about the way my child thought logically through problems as we worked this puzzle together, many years ago. (Ignore the 80’s hairdo!)

Puzzles can be a fun diversion.  But do you know that they also will help your child develop the following skills?

* color, shape, and pattern identification and matching,
* recognition of integrated parts, and their relationship to the whole,
* fine motor skills and eye-hand coordination,
* problem solving skills, and
* the ability to make choices independently (even when uncertain about the outcome) with self-confidence.

In my occupational therapy work with young elementary school children, I often used picture puzzles. Puzzles can be used to teach kids new skills and also offer a window into a child’s mind. Watching a child and having him verbalize what he’s thinking helps you to better understand his ability to problem solve.

Following are eight developmental stages in puzzle problem solving, which I believe children move through sequentially, from preschool through elementary school.  Thinking about the stages your child has passed through (and the stage he is currently in) will help you choose appropriate puzzles for him.

Understanding how your child is thinking makes playing with him more exciting, as you see him go from one stage to another. This also may give you clues as to how your child problem solves in general, which may affect his schoolwork as he grows older.

Let’s begin, using a typical preschool puzzle (separate holes for each piece; differences in shape are obvious), with:

1) HOLE FILLING: A very young child discovers that holes in a puzzle can be filled with loose pieces.  She usually tries to push all pieces in all holes (regardless of color or shape) to “make” them fit.

2) MATCHING HOLES AND PIECES: She now realizes that each hole has only one corresponding piece.  Tends to rely on color  to find the correct one.

3) RECOGNITION OF DIFFERENCES IN SIZE and SHAPES:  Your child now takes size and shape into consideration, looking closely at both holes and pieces.  Finds the correct one more quickly.  Does not yet understand turning a piece to make it fit, however (especially if small protrusions mean the piece fits only one way).   May abandon the correct piece and try another, incorrect one.

4) MANIPULATION: She will turn a piece to see if it fits.

At any of the above stages, after completing a puzzle, your child may be able to re-do it easily alone by simply relying on her memory and fine motor skills.  But she may now be ready to tackle a jigsaw puzzle, with interlocking parts and an outside boundary (cardboard back with raised edge on all sides), using the following skills:

5) INTERRELATING PIECES AND SORTING:

Your child sees relationships between pieces; begins to sort and group them by similarities in color and design.  He is beginning to discern tiny differences between pieces; and may compare the puzzle pieces to the design printed on the box.  Realizes the scale is different.  May not yet understand significance of straight edges on the sides of some pieces.

6) VISUALIZATION and PART S V.S.  WHOLE:

He now can “see” in his mind, how pieces will look together (i.e., pieces with a black line running through them, together will form one continuous line.)  He sees individual sections, as well as the whole. (ex., clown puzzle: sorts out face pieces, even if different shapes and colors, then leg pieces, etc.)

7) MIRRORED OPPOSITES:  She now does the above, but also with  mirrored opposites. (i.e., a butterfly; wings pointing opposite directions.)  Visualizes how pieces will look together; reverses images in her mind.  Recognizes similarities despite reversed directions.

     Now your child can move on to standard jigsaw puzzles, done on a table with no confining frame.

8) CORNERS AND EDGES (square puzzles):  She realizes that two connecting straight edges, at 90 degrees, makes a corner piece.  Know there are only four such pieces; will actively look for them.  Realizes that only one straight edge indicates that piece will create an edge of the completed puzzle.

Note: Your child may be able to do a 70 piece jigsaw puzzle alone after trying it a few times with you, but still not understand corners and edges.  He may still rely on visual memory (remembering how the puzzle looked when it was completed).

By the end of first grade, your child should progress through the first five stages (and may progress through all eight).  If by fourth grade he still seems unable to grasp the concepts in stages 6 & 7, a learning problem might be indicated.

Watch your child do a puzzle. You can practically see how he thinks as he looks and sorts pieces.  If he struggles, have him verbalize how he’s figuring it out.  Resist the urge to tell where pieces go as you coach him. Model problem solving by asking questions: “How are these two pieces alike?” “This piece has a straight edge–where could it fit?”.  Don’t forget to be cheerleader too, giving your child an enthusiastic “Yay!” when he’s successful.
